Venue TypeRestaurantGastropubAddress2101 Greenville Avenue, Dallas, TXNeighborhoodLowest GreenvilleRequest Pricing
Venue TypeRestaurantGastropubAddress2101 Greenville Avenue, Dallas, TXNeighborhoodLowest GreenvilleRequest Pricing